Why Energy-Efficient Windows Matter

Windows are typically the weakest link in a home's insulation. Inadequately sealed or damaged windows can cause drafts, moisture infiltration, and eventually higher energy costs. According to studies, approximately 30% of a home's heating and cooling energy can be lost through windows. This loss not only effects energy consumption but likewise affects indoor convenience.

The benefits of energy-efficient windows include:

  • Reduced Energy Costs: Properly insulated windows can reduce heating and cooling expenditures.
  • Enhanced Comfort: Well-maintained windows keep indoor temperature levels more stable.
  • Increased Home Value: Energy-efficient upgrades can increase a home's market price.
  • Ecological Impact: Lower energy usage adds to a reduction in greenhouse gas emissions.

Kinds Of Window Repairs

Repairing windows can take numerous kinds, depending on the concerns at hand. Common kinds of window repairs that enhance energy effectiveness consist of:

  1. Weatherstripping: Installing or replacing weatherstripping helps seal gaps around the window, avoiding air leakage.

  2. Caulking: Applying caulk around window frames can fill out fractures and gaps that add to energy loss.

  3. Glass Repair or Replacement: Broken or cloudy glass reduces insulation. Alternatives include fixing the glass or replacing it with double or triple-pane units.

  4. Frame Repair: Wooden frames might rot or deteriorate gradually. Repairing or replacing the frame can enhance the overall efficiency of the window.

  5. Insulating Window Treatments: Adding insulating window treatments, such as cellular tones, can further improve the energy efficiency of existing windows.

Cost of Window Repairs

The cost of window repairs can differ commonly depending upon the type of repair needed and the materials used. Below is a basic introduction of potential costs connected with typical window repair types:

Repair TypeTypical Cost Range (per window)
Weatherstripping₤ 10 - ₤ 30
Caulking₤ 5 - ₤ 15
Glass Repair₤ 50 - ₤ 200
Glass Replacement₤ 200 - ₤ 500
Frame Repair₤ 50 - ₤ 150
Insulating Treatments₤ 30 - ₤ 100

Regularly Asked Questions (FAQ)

1. How do I understand if my windows require repairs?

Signs your windows may need repair consist of drafts, condensation in between panes, noticeable fractures or spaces, and trouble opening or closing them.

2. Can I carry out window repairs myself?

For minor repairs like caulking and weatherstripping, homeowners can often do it themselves. However, for considerable problems like glass replacement or frame repair, it may be smart to employ a professional.

3. How typically should I examine my windows for energy performance?

It's advisable to check your windows each year, especially before heating or cooling seasons, to ensure they stay energy efficient.

4. What are the benefits of double or triple-pane windows?

Double and triple-pane windows provide better insulation than single-pane options, reducing energy loss and improving comfort in severe temperatures.

5. Will energy-efficient window repair receive tax credits?

Homeowners may receive tax credits or refunds for energy-efficient upgrades, consisting of window repairs. It is vital to examine local or federal programs for eligibility.
